Destination Maternity Key Nov. Sales Figure Falls
PHILADELPHIA (AP) ¿ Destination Maternity Corp. said unfavorable weather, a difficult comparison and the ongoing struggles of the retail sector during the recession contributed to an 11.6 percent drop in a key sales figure in November.
Still, the maternity apparel retailer said the results were in line with its expectations for a monthly decline between 10 percent and 12.5 percent.
This sales figure is a key indicator of retailer performance since it measures growth at existing stores rather than newly opened ones.
Adjusting for one more Monday and one less Saturday compared with the prior-year period, sales at stores open at least a year fell about 8.1 percent in November. This was in range of Destination's forecast for a decline of 6.5 percent to 9 percent on an adjusted basis.
Total monthly sales slipped 3.1 percent to $42.7 million. Retailers have come under pressure during the recession as shoppers have pulled back considerably on their spending and continue to seek out discounts and trade down.
